What is On The Dock?


1.

To be excluded from a group of people who are seemingly enjoying themselves. The opposite feeling of "on the yacht."

example 1:

Steve- "Where is mike? I thought he was coming to this club?"

James- "They wouldn't let him in... I guess he is on the dock now."

example 2:

"Everyone is talking about Stephanie's party last night... i was not invited. I'm totally on the dock right now."
